The full picture

Villa Tara’s biggest asset is the setting: a polished country villa with a carefully kept garden, poolside tables, and an elegant white interior. Reviews repeatedly describe it as relaxing and especially attractive for aperitivi, breakfasts, weddings, baptisms, and other celebrations—one guest’s shorthand was that the atmosphere felt almost magical. Service is another reliable bright spot, with staff frequently described as courteous, professional, and accommodating. The cooking is traditional Northern Italian in spirit, covering cured meats and gnocco fritto, risotti, fresh pasta, seafood, beef, and homemade-style desserts. The menu is broad rather than highly experimental, and the strongest detailed praise goes to the tender tagliata, seafood starters, and breakfast pastries. Still, the food is not invulnerable: one recent review found the meal merely average, while an older return visit reported disappointing gnocco fritto and cream-heavy gnocchi. This looks like a venue where the occasion, room, and hospitality are part of the value—not just the plate. Families and groups should find Villa Tara welcoming, particularly for organized celebrations. The menu includes familiar choices such as fried potatoes, roast meat, cutlet-style preparations, fresh pasta, fruit with gelato, and simple desserts, while a recent event review reports successful lactose-, peanut-, and celiac-friendly accommodations. There is no dedicated children’s menu shown, so picky eaters may need guidance, but the broad Italian selection is more accessible than a highly formal tasting menu.
